Cebuano[edit]

Pronunciation[edit]

  • Hyphenation: wa‧lo‧wa‧lo

Etymology 1[edit]

Compare tigwalo, tigwaw and sigwalo.

Noun[edit]

walowalo

  1. the yellow-lipped sea krait (Laticauda colubrina)

Etymology 2[edit]

Unknown.

Noun[edit]

walowalo

  1. the southwesterly wind
